Hunt Companies in El Paso, TX is seeking a Benefits Manager to oversee employee benefits programs, the 401(k) plan, and related compliance. You will lead a team and collaborate with brokers and vendors, reporting to the VP of HR.
The role requires 4–6 years in benefits with supervisory experience, HRIS proficiency, and strong knowledge of ERISA, ACA, HIPAA, COBRA, and ADA. You will design programs, manage open enrollment, and communicate benefits to staff.
Reporting to the Vice President of Human Resources, the Benefits Manager plays a critical role within the organization, managing administrative tasks related to employee benefits programs, 401k retirement plan, and supporting the design and implementation of new programs. This role will work closely with Human Resources leadership, benefits brokers, and vendors to ensure the company remains compliant with applicable laws and regulations.
